Timo Meier scores 2 to lead Sharks past Blues 6-3 in Game 1

SAN JOSE, Calif. (AP) – Timo Meier scored twice and set up one of Logan Couture’s two goals with a hard hit, sending the San Jose Sharks to a 6-3 victory over the St. Louis Blues in Game 1 of the Western Conference final Saturday night.

Flyers sign F Boulerice, C DowdFlyers sign F Boulerice, C Dowd

The Philadelphia Flyers signed forward Jesse Boulerice and center Jim Dowd to one-year contracts Wednesday. The 29-year-old Boulerice had one assist and a team-high 47 penalty minutes in six preseason games. In 16 games with Albany of the AHL last season, he had four goals and three assists.
